Photoview 是一款专为摄影师打造的照片库应用,以其简洁的用户界面和高效的浏览体验而闻名。它允许用户快速浏览包含大量高分辨率照片的目录,并支持在文件系统中的目录中搜索照片和视频。Photoview 的扫描功能能够自动识别媒体文件并生成缩略图,大幅提升浏览速度。
该应用深度整合了文件系统,使得服务器上的本地文件系统图像可以直接展示,且目录与相册一一对应。用户管理功能允许每个用户与本地文件系统上的特定路径关联,确保用户只能访问授权的照片。Photoview 提供了便捷的共享功能,用户可以通过生成的公共链接分享相册和媒体文件,且这些链接可以选择性地设置密码保护。
Photoview 在设计时充分考虑了摄影师的需求,特别支持 RAW 文件格式和 EXIF 数据解析,满足专业摄影工作的需求。视频功能方面,它支持多种常见视频格式,并自动对视频进行网络优化。人脸识别技术的应用使得系统能够自动检测照片中的人脸,并将相似照片归类整理。
在性能方面,Photoview 自动生成的缩略图会在用户浏览时优先加载,全屏模式下则持续显示缩略图,直至高分辨率图像完全加载。安全特性上,所有媒体资源都通过 cookie 令牌进行保护,密码经过加密哈希处理,API 采用严格的 CORS 策略,确保用户数据的安全。
地址:
https://github.com/photoview/photoview